Who lives here?

Dorset Park, Toronto is an east Toronto neighbourhood notable for its salespeople and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, particularly those from the Philippines, India and Sri Lanka, and Tagalog and Tamil speakers.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of babies, kids aged 5 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24 and adults aged 40 to 64.
